Pending orders for two months
Some of my orders pending for a long time (2 months) what is the reason for that ? I want either the products or the money. It comes to me that some buyers that are not buyers but sellers in the same list are misusing Amazon's policy to keep my product as hostage. If so this not fair at all.

This is quite common, we can have pages of pending orders, and I think the record we had was 3 months. There is nothing you can do about this unfortunately, even if you zero the stock, the pending orders still remain.
It is a tactic used by competitors from time to time, you can limit the damage by setting a maximum order quantity which prevents them from putting your entire inventory into pending.
Seller_wA3Q6hSOKG6WF
Hi, you can report instances of potential competitor inventory hold abuse to amazon directly by going to Account Health, Report Abuse of Amazon Policies, 'A competitor is placing orders to hold my inventory.' Hopefully this helps, also placing max order qty's is a good idea to stop unscrupulous sellers from doing this to hold your stock hostage.
